Output d95e694024ab79467cdb71f6c94cfae0dba96409dbb57fa467e3ab1fd02afee2:16

value
588935
script pubkey
OP_0 OP_PUSHBYTES_20 e96ff762b702333eb8a29a4157f19263b34edec4
address
bc1qa9hlwc4hqgenaw9znfq40uvjvwe5ahkyfr0ess
transaction
d95e694024ab79467cdb71f6c94cfae0dba96409dbb57fa467e3ab1fd02afee2
spent
true